These young superstars are ready to conquer the 2026 World Cup.

VHO - The 2026 World Cup is calling for the brightest young talents in world football. They have just had explosive seasons at the club level and are expected to shine in the USA, Mexico, and Canada. Below are six of the most noteworthy players.

1. Lamine Yamal (18 years old - Spain)

Lamine Yamal, a gem of Spanish football, is entering the 2026 World Cup with the baggage of a stellar season despite being only 18 years old. Wearing the Barcelona shirt, Yamal played 45 matches, scoring 24 goals and providing 18 assists – numbers that have impressed football experts.

At Euro 2024, he was a key player in helping "La Roja" win the championship. With his innate technique and rare confidence, the striker born in 2007 continues to be Spain's number one hope in attack at this tournament.

2. Pau Cubarsi (19 years old - Spain)

Alongside Yamal in the back line is Pau Cubarsi, the 19-year-old center-back who is astonishing all of Europe. Last season, Cubarsi played 48 matches for Barcelona, ​​an incredible number for a defender at such a young age.

The 2007-born player's greatest strengths are his composure and excellent game-reading ability, qualities usually only seen in seasoned central defenders. Cubarsi has a strong chance of securing a starting spot in the Spanish national team.

3. Kobbie Mainoo (21 years old - UK)

England are bringing a completely transformed Kobbie Mainoo to the 2026 World Cup. Under the tutelage of interim manager Michael Carrick at Manchester United, the 21-year-old midfielder has risen to become a key player in the midfield.

Playing alongside Casemiro and Bruno Fernandes, Mainoo delivered explosive performances, helping the "Red Devils" finish third in the Premier League. His brilliant form convinced manager Thomas Tuchel to immediately include him in the World Cup squad.

4. Lennart Karl (18 years old - Germany)

The German national team has high expectations for Lennart Karl, the 18-year-old talent from Bayern Munich. Specializing in the attacking midfield and right wing positions, Karl brings excitement with his technical skill and blistering speed.

This season, he has scored 9 goals and provided 8 assists for Bayern Munich. With his high ability to create game-changing moments, Karl is considered a dangerous asset in the hands of the German national team's coaching staff.

5. Endrick (19 years old - Brazil)

From Brazil, Endrick rose to prominence after his loan move to Olympique Lyon. In France, the 19-year-old striker proved his class with 8 goals and 9 assists in just 21 appearances.

Not only is Endrick sharp in the penalty area, but he is also highly regarded for his ability to connect with others and contribute to the team's overall play, thus earning him a place in the Selecao squad aiming for the World Cup.

6. Warren Zaire-Emery (20 years old - France)

The French national team has been strengthened by the addition of Warren Zaire-Emery, the 20-year-old midfielder who consistently ranks among the world's most promising talents. At PSG, despite fierce competition from Vitinha, Joao Neves, and Fabian Ruiz, the player born in 2006 always manages to make an impact whenever he's on the pitch.

Zaire-Emery's unpredictability promises to be a valuable weapon for "Les Bleus" on their journey to conquer the championship.
